Kate Moss’s New Airport Shoes Are Unexpected—And Undeniably Cool, Too

For some of the globe’s most stylish celebrities, the walk to and from the airport doubles as a runway. A-list stars such as Kim Kardashian West and Victoria Beckham, not to mention royals Meghan Markle and Kate Middleton, have nailed the art of elevated airport style, choosing on-the-go looks that are comfortable and practical, but super polished, too. Another such master of travel fashion? Kate Moss.

Today, the supermodel was spotted touching down in Incheon, South Korea, and her signature effortless-cool aesthetic was in full effect as she de-planed. She also proved that an airport shoe doesn’t always have to mean comfy sneakers.

Being the trendsetter that she is, Moss chose a more offbeat shoe style for her airport look: cool cowboy boots. Cut from black leather, the calf-grazing footwear was undeniably sleek, especially paired with the rest of her outfit: a gray topcoat, polka dot blouse, skinny black jeans, and poppy red shoulder. Western boots happen to be a major trend for spring, so it’s unsurprising that Moss is already jumping on the yee-haw! movement, though her take was more high fashion than rodeo ready. And given that cowboy boots slip on and off at the drop of hat, going through TSA supermodel style came with zero stress.
